Bedford A Still in Pole Position

 
Bedford A retained top spot in the Beds League with an emphatic 4-1 victory over LB A on Feb 25th.We are now 3 points clear with 3 matches left and, indeed, could clinch the crown with a victory over MK A in our next match.

Things got off to a great start when Steve Law blundered badly on Board 5 and Steve Pike swept in to secure an early victory after about half an hour. (see minigame below)
 
Paul was also doing very well on Board 4, when Peter Hunt allowed him to win a pawn for very little just out of the opening, but things drifted somewhat and Paul ended up with a bad bishop V knight ending and, getting short of time, accepted Peter’s draw offer.
 
Nick’s game on Board 3 was a miniature of fluctuating fortunes that culminated in a rather nice finish from Nick.  ( See Game Below ).
 
Having taken my first half point off Tukpetov in 5 attempts, in the reverse fixture in December, I approached this game with slightly less of a feeling of impending doom than usual. It was also my first time with white since 2016 !  In the event, he outplayed me in the opening (as usual) following 1. d4 c5, although Stockfish doesn’t think my position was quite as bad as I’d thought at the time, before playing a couple of inaccurate moves to expose his own king and letting me get in an e5 break. This pretty much forced a long series of exchanges which ended up in a double rook + 3 pawns each ending. I may actually have had decent winning chances but, with 2 minutes versus 45 and needing a half to secure the match, I saw a forced draw and took it. 
 
With the match secured, we gathered round Ravi’s board to watch the conclusion. Ravi seemed to be doing quite nicely, with 2 lovely Bishops, and, indeed, a few moves later he won a piece and John Sharp threw in the towel a few moves later.
 
So a resounding and satisfying 4-1 win it was.
